What Is an Eye Pillow?
An eye pillow is a small, gently weighted pillow designed to rest over your closed eyes. Typically filled with flax seed or linseed, and often scented with natural lavender, eye pillows use the principles of gentle pressure therapy and aromatherapy to encourage deep relaxation. They are a staple of yoga studios, meditation practices, and natural wellness routines worldwide.

The Many Uses of an Eye Pillow
1. Yoga & Meditation
Eye pillows are perhaps best known as a yoga prop. During yoga nidra (yogic sleep), savasana, or any restorative pose, placing an eye pillow over the eyes signals to the nervous system that it is time to rest. The gentle weight stimulates the oculocardiac reflex — a natural response that slows the heart rate and promotes a deep sense of calm.
For meditation, an eye pillow blocks out visual distractions, helping you turn your attention inward and deepen your practice.
2. Restful Sleep
Struggling to switch off at night? An eye pillow can help. The combination of complete light blockout and gentle pressure encourages the body to produce melatonin — the hormone that regulates sleep. Add a lavender-scented eye pillow and you have a powerful, natural sleep aid without any medication.
Unlike rigid sleep masks, a flax seed eye pillow moulds gently to the contours of your face, making it far more comfortable for side and back sleepers alike.
3. Headache & Migraine Relief
For tension headaches and migraines, an eye pillow used cool can provide significant relief. Place it in a sealed bag in the freezer for 30 minutes, then rest it gently over your eyes and forehead. The cool weight helps reduce inflammation and ease the throbbing sensation that accompanies a migraine.
Used warm (microwave for 10-20 seconds), an eye pillow can ease sinus pressure and tension headaches caused by stress or screen fatigue.
4. Screen Fatigue & Eye Strain
In an age of screens, eye strain is increasingly common. After a long day at a computer or phone, resting with a cool eye pillow for just 10-15 minutes can significantly reduce puffiness, redness, and that tired, gritty feeling. It is a simple, effective, and entirely natural remedy.
5. Stress & Anxiety Relief
The gentle pressure of a flax seed eye pillow activates the parasympathetic nervous system — your body's natural "rest and digest" mode. This makes eye pillows a wonderful tool for managing everyday stress and anxiety. Pair with slow, deep breathing and the calming scent of lavender for maximum effect.
6. Reducing Puffiness & Dark Circles
Used cool, an eye pillow can help reduce morning puffiness and the appearance of dark circles. The gentle cold compress constricts blood vessels around the eyes, reducing swelling and leaving you looking refreshed.
7. Post-Surgery or Illness Recovery
Eye pillows are often recommended after certain eye procedures or during illness recovery to encourage rest and reduce light sensitivity. Always consult your healthcare provider before use in a medical context.

Flax Seed vs Lavender Eye Pillows — What's the Difference?
Flax seed eye pillows (unscented) are ideal for those sensitive to fragrance, or for use in a yoga class where strong scents may be distracting to others. The flax seed filling provides the gentle weight and moulds beautifully to the face.
Lavender eye pillows combine the weight of flax seed with the calming aromatherapy benefits of natural English lavender. The scent is released gently as the pillow warms to your skin, making them particularly effective for sleep and stress relief.

How to Care for Your Eye Pillow
- Surface clean only with a damp cloth — do not immerse in water
- To freshen the lavender scent, place in a warm (not hot) airing cupboard for a few hours
-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ight
- If using cool, always place in a sealed bag before freezing to protect the fabric
